服务器的设置,深度解析,服务器端环境设置攻略与最佳实践
- 综合资讯
- 2025-04-11 09:37:05
- 2

服务器设置深度解析涵盖服务器端环境配置攻略与最佳实践,旨在提供详尽的设置指导,包括环境搭建、性能优化、安全措施等,帮助用户构建高效、稳定的服务器系统。...
服务器设置深度解析涵盖服务器端环境配置攻略与最佳实践,旨在提供详尽的设置指导,包括环境搭建、性能优化、安全措施等,帮助用户构建高效、稳定的服务器系统。
随着互联网技术的飞速发展,服务器在各个行业中的应用越来越广泛,作为承载网站、应用程序、数据库等核心业务的平台,服务器端环境的设置对于系统的稳定性和性能至关重要,本文将深入解析服务器端环境设置的方法与最佳实践,帮助读者构建高效、稳定的服务器环境。
服务器硬件选择
-
CPU:选择性能稳定的CPU,如Intel Xeon、AMD EPYC等,保证服务器处理能力强,降低故障率。
-
内存:根据业务需求选择合适的内存容量,建议配置8GB以上,以满足多任务处理和缓存需求。
-
存储:硬盘选择SSD,提高读写速度;根据业务需求选择合适的RAID级别,如RAID 5、RAID 10等,保证数据安全。
图片来源于网络,如有侵权联系删除
-
网卡:选择千兆网卡,提高网络传输速度;若需负载均衡,可配置多块网卡。
-
电源:选择电源稳定的电源模块,保证服务器正常运行。
操作系统与软件选择
-
操作系统:根据业务需求选择合适的操作系统,如Linux、Windows Server等,Linux系统具有稳定性、安全性、可定制性等优点,广泛应用于服务器端环境。
-
数据库:根据业务需求选择合适的数据库,如MySQL、Oracle、SQL Server等,MySQL适用于中小型业务,Oracle适用于大型企业级应用。
-
应用服务器:根据业务需求选择合适的应用服务器,如Apache、Nginx、Tomcat等,Nginx和Apache适用于静态网站和应用程序,Tomcat适用于Java应用。
-
服务器管理软件:选择易于管理的服务器管理软件,如CentOS、Ubuntu等。
服务器端环境设置
-
网络配置:设置静态IP地址、子网掩码、网关,确保服务器网络连通性。
-
系统优化:关闭不必要的系统服务,提高系统稳定性,如关闭DNS服务、NTP服务、防火墙等。
-
硬件监控:安装硬件监控软件,实时监控CPU、内存、硬盘、网络等硬件指标,确保硬件正常运行。
-
软件安装:根据业务需求安装相应的软件,如数据库、应用服务器等。
-
安全设置:设置防火墙策略,限制非法访问;安装杀毒软件,防止病毒感染。
-
系统备份:定期备份系统数据,确保数据安全。
图片来源于网络,如有侵权联系删除
服务器性能优化
-
内存优化:合理配置内存,避免内存泄漏;优化应用程序,减少内存占用。
-
硬盘优化:定期检查磁盘空间,清理无用文件;优化文件系统,提高读写速度。
-
网络优化:调整TCP/IP参数,提高网络传输速度;配置负载均衡,实现多服务器协同工作。
-
应用程序优化:优化代码,提高应用程序性能;采用缓存技术,减少数据库访问次数。
服务器监控与维护
-
定期检查服务器运行状态,确保系统稳定。
-
监控服务器资源使用情况,如CPU、内存、硬盘、网络等。
-
及时处理故障,降低故障率。
-
定期更新操作系统和软件,确保系统安全性。
-
培训技术人员,提高维护水平。
服务器端环境设置是构建高效、稳定服务器的基础,本文从硬件、软件、优化、监控等方面对服务器端环境设置进行了深入解析,旨在帮助读者掌握服务器端环境设置的方法与最佳实践,在实际操作过程中,还需根据业务需求进行调整,以实现最佳效果。
本文链接:https://www.zhitaoyun.cn/2070098.html
发表评论